ENTRYWAY COLLECTION - Grand Tour Style
A large carved red cinnabar-style lacquer floor vase or umbrella cane stand by the Beijing Lacquer Factory, richly decorated in deep relief with blooming peonies, layered foliage, and a graceful long-tailed pheasant. The intricate carving is enhanced with hand-finished incised details that bring definition to the feathers, petals, and leaves, while dark brass bands at the rim and base provide a refined architectural finish.
Designed as a statement floor vessel or umbrella cane stand, its impressive scale and richly textured surface make it an elegant addition to an entryway, library, study, or living room. Equally striking in traditional, Chinoiserie, and transitional interiors, it offers both sculptural presence and practical function.

COLLECTOR'S NOTE
Produced during the late 20th century at the Beijing Lacquer Factory, this large cinnabar-style vessel reflects a transitional moment in Chinese decorative arts—when traditional lacquer-carving techniques were adapted to modern materials and export tastes. The bold floral panels and pheasant perched on a rocky outcrop were molded in high relief, then selectively refined by hand, a method characteristic of higher-quality factory work of the period.
While not antique cinnabar carved layer-by-layer in the classical manner, these factory-era pieces are increasingly appreciated as the last generation of large-scale Chinese lacquer production. With the original Beijing workshops now closed and lacquerwork shifting to small artisan studios, vessels of this size and complexity are no longer made today, lending vintage examples renewed appeal for collectors and decorators alike.
